Notes

Scarlet (she/they) is a queer, plus sized, neurodiverse, disabled artist and advocate. An inaugural graduate of the Bachelor of Music Theatre at the Elder Conservatorium Of Music (University of Adelaide), Scarlet made their professional debut in Priscilla Queen of the Desert (Matt Ward Entertainment). Scarlet was part of the development of Vic Zerbst’s new Australian musical Converted! before joining its premiere season with ATYP and Sydney Festival as Swing/Dance Captain. They went on to perform in Guys & Dolls on Sydney Harbour (Opera Australia) as Ensemble/MC and General Matilda B Cartwright Cover. Most recently, Scarlet made their Hayes Theatre debut as Jolene in Dirty Rotten Scoundrels (Redfern Lane) As well as performing in musical theatre productions, Scarlet is a versatile actor working across multiple screen projects including Miss Sultanah which premiere’s on SBS in 2026. They’re also skilled cabaret and burlesque performer known for their fabulous movement, comedic chops, and their bold, powerful voice.
